Jairo "JC" Carrion “JC” Carrion immigrated to the United States in 1986, fleeing political persecution from his native country, Nicaragua. He has over 25 years of experience in the recruitment industry and has partnered with leading organizations across a wide range of industries, including Life Sciences, Financial Technology, Consumer Goods, and Autonomous Driving. myTOD, LLC is the fulfillment of a commitment made 33 years ago after Carrion's first experience with a recruiting agency where he struggled to get traditional recruiters to see his true talent. He felt the frustration of being placed in unsuitable roles and swore the same experience wouldn’t happen to others in the future. The model at myTOD is built on values that come straight from the heart, forged through real-life experiences, and fueled by a passion for disrupting the world of talent acquisition. It is also built on the promise to pay back for the mentorship and support he received throughout his career as a young professional. myTOD is committed to nurturing the talent of 1,000 disadvantaged teenagers by 2025, and 10,000 by 2032. -- Critical Mass Business Talk Show is Orange County, CA's longest-running business talk show, focused on offering value and insight to middle-market business leaders in the OC and beyond.
